Can I bring my pet on board?

Yes, pets are allowed on ferries from Pisaetos, Ithaca to Kyllini, but specific policies vary by ferry company. General guidelines:

  • Pets over 10 kg must be kept in the ship’s onboard kennels; pets under 10 kg can stay in their owner’s pet carrier.
  • Service dogs are exempt from kennel requirements.
  • Ensure you have all the necessary documents, tickets, and pet essentials for your trip.
  • Greek operators typically allow pets for free.

The Kyllini ferry terminal is situated approximately 65 kilometers from Patras and offers direct connections to Zakynthos and Kefalonia. It's near the village of Kyllini, where you can find amenities and accommodations.

Exploring Kyllini

Kyllini is a lovely beach town in Greece that has something special for everyone! One of its best features is the beautiful sandy beaches where you can splash in the clear blue water. A visit to the Kyllini Castle gives you a peek into the past, with amazing views all around.

While you’re here, don’t miss out on trying some tasty local food, especially fresh seafood and the delicious olives grown nearby. There are also hidden gems like the hot springs in the area, where you can relax and enjoy nature.

Kyllini is perfect for a short visit because you can soak up the sun or explore the charming town. It's also a great starting point for adventures to nearby islands like Zakynthos, where you can see the famous Navagio Beach. You can go hiking in the lush hills surrounding the town or take a boat trip to discover secret coves. With so much to see and do, Kyllini is a fun place for families and friends alike!
